Output 7c3a81a617fe3987cacf2e2c554fe8c629da0e3875e713416c21f809688e14b5:23

value
51245082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 021c32be2dfc955c2a6da98947bfe244ef650e3b OP_EQUAL
address
M86KN4SYXUiH6TVCxFoLLWBSJ8T5BLzabr
transaction
7c3a81a617fe3987cacf2e2c554fe8c629da0e3875e713416c21f809688e14b5
spent
true